Physical Size and Portability

One of the primary advantages of a 5 - Inch Touch Panel is its compact size. The relatively small physical footprint makes it highly portable. For example, in the automotive industry, a 5 Inch Capacitive Touch Screen For Car can be easily installed in the dashboard without taking up too much space. This compactness also allows for flexibility in device design. Manufacturers can integrate 5 - Inch Touch Panels into various products, such as handheld medical devices, portable gaming consoles, and smart home control panels.

The small size, however, can also present some challenges in terms of operation. The limited screen real estate means that there is less space for on - screen elements. Buttons, icons, and text need to be carefully designed to ensure they are large enough to be easily tapped. If the elements are too small, users may find it difficult to accurately select what they want, leading to frustration and potentially incorrect inputs.

Touch Sensitivity

Touch sensitivity is a crucial factor in determining the ease of operation of a touch panel. A 5 - Inch Touch Panel typically uses either resistive or capacitive technology. Capacitive touch screens, like the 5 inch lcd display Touch Screen, are more popular due to their superior touch sensitivity. They can detect the slightest touch, even with a light tap of a finger. This high sensitivity allows for smooth and responsive interactions, such as swiping through menus, zooming in and out of maps, or typing on a virtual keyboard.

Resistive touch screens, on the other hand, require a bit more pressure to register a touch. While they are generally less expensive, the need for additional pressure can make the operation less intuitive, especially for users who are accustomed to the light - touch nature of capacitive screens. Moreover, resistive touch screens may be more prone to wear and tear over time, as the repeated pressure can cause the layers of the screen to degrade.

Multi - Touch Support

Another aspect of operation is multi - touch support. Modern 5 - Inch Touch Panels, especially those using capacitive technology, often support multi - touch gestures. This means that users can perform actions such as pinching to zoom, rotating an image, or using two fingers to scroll. Multi - touch support greatly enhances the user experience and makes the operation more natural and efficient.

For example, in a photo - viewing application on a 5 - Inch Touch Panel, users can easily zoom in on a specific part of a photo by pinching their fingers together. This kind of interaction mimics how we interact with physical objects in the real world, making it more intuitive. However, the implementation of multi - touch support needs to be well - calibrated. If the touch panel misinterprets multi - touch gestures, it can lead to unexpected actions and a poor user experience.

User Interface Design

The design of the user interface (UI) plays a significant role in the ease of operation of a 5 - Inch Touch Panel. A well - designed UI takes into account the limitations of the small screen size. It uses clear and concise icons, legible text, and logical navigation structures. For instance, menus should be organized in a hierarchical manner, with the most important options easily accessible.

Color contrast is also important. Using high - contrast colors for buttons and text ensures that they stand out on the screen, making them easier to see and select. Additionally, the UI should provide visual feedback to the user when an action is performed. For example, a button can change color or slightly shrink when tapped, indicating that the touch has been registered.

Application - Specific Considerations

The ease of operation of a 5 - Inch Touch Panel can also vary depending on the application. In a simple application, such as a basic calculator or a flashlight app, the operation is usually straightforward. The limited number of functions and on - screen elements make it easy for users to find what they need.

However, in more complex applications, such as a navigation system or a video - editing tool, the operation can be more challenging. These applications often require users to perform multiple steps and use a variety of functions. In such cases, the UI design becomes even more critical. The application needs to provide clear instructions and tutorials to help users understand how to use the different features.

Comparing with Larger Touch Panels

When compared to larger touch panels, a 5 - Inch Touch Panel has its own set of advantages and disadvantages in terms of operation. Larger touch panels offer more screen space, which means that there is more room for on - screen elements. This can make it easier to display detailed information and provide a more immersive experience.

However, larger touch panels may not be as portable as 5 - Inch Touch Panels. They are also more expensive and may require more power to operate. In some cases, a 5 - Inch Touch Panel may be the better choice, especially when portability and cost are important factors.
